About Naturalistic Terrariums

Naturalistic terrariums provide a stunning and functional habitat for reptiles, amphibians, and other small creatures, mimicking their natural environments. These terrariums are designed with a variety of decor elements such as cork, wood, and natural stones, creating a visually appealing and enriching space that promotes the well-being of your pets. By incorporating elements like hides, climbing structures, and suitable substrates, these terrariums not only enhance the aesthetic of your living space but also cater to the specific needs of your animals.

Utilizing natural materials in terrarium design helps maintain humidity levels and provides essential hiding spots, which are crucial for the health and comfort of your pets. Whether you are setting up a tropical rainforest, a desert landscape, or a woodland habitat, our selection of naturalistic terrarium components allows you to create a customized environment that supports the natural behaviors of your reptiles and amphibians. With the right combination of decor and substrate, you can ensure a thriving ecosystem that is both beautiful and functional.

What are the benefits of using naturalistic terrariums?

  • Naturalistic terrariums offer a more enriching environment for pets, promoting natural behaviors and reducing stress. They also enhance the visual appeal of your home while providing essential habitats for reptiles and amphibians.

What materials are commonly used in naturalistic terrariums?

  • Common materials include natural cork, wood, stones, and various substrates like coconut fiber or moss, which help create a realistic and functional habitat for your pets.

How do I maintain humidity in a naturalistic terrarium?

  • Maintaining humidity can be achieved by using appropriate substrates, incorporating live plants, and regularly misting the enclosure. Additionally, using a water dish can help regulate moisture levels.

Can I use live plants in my naturalistic terrarium?

  • Yes, live plants can be a great addition to naturalistic terrariums, providing additional hiding spots, improving air quality, and contributing to the overall aesthetics of the habitat.

What types of animals are suitable for naturalistic terrariums?

  • Naturalistic terrariums are ideal for a variety of reptiles and amphibians, including geckos, snakes, frogs, and turtles, as they provide the necessary environment for these species to thrive.
